## Deploying the Gatewick Proctor Queue

Deploys are pretty painless: push to main, wait for the pipeline, then watch the queue drain dashboard for five minutes. If candidates pile up mid-exam, roll back first and ask questions later — the queue replays safely. Everything the workers care about lives in one config block, shown here for reference.

settings of bafof-yagef:
JOROX_PIN=8740
JOROX_TENANT=pelox
JOROX_METRICS_HOST=metrics.jorox.qorvelworks.internal
JOROX_SEAL=seal_c78f63c1
JOROX_STANDBY_TEAM=norax

// Date localization client setup.
// Formats are fetched at runtime from the internal Calendrix
// locale service rather than bundled, so regional pattern fixes
// ship without a client release. Responses are cached 24h and
// validated against a pinned schema; no user data is sent.
// Reviewer note: transport is mTLS inside the Hollowgate mesh.
// The client authenticates to Calendrix with the key below.

service key, fawip-bajef: kto11_Qt5wZK9vdNC

Leadership Review Briefing — Calder Bay Expansion. Heads of department: Norwick Systems will open its first Calder Bay office in Q2. Initial staffing is twelve roles, split between sales and support. Lease terms are agreed; fit-out begins next month. Regulatory filings are on track. Department leads should confirm resourcing impacts by Friday. The confidential expansion terms are set out immediately below.

internal memo for kawip-hadug: Headcount on the Wenwyn team goes from 7 to 140 by the end of January. Gross margin on Wenwyn came in at 20 percent against a plan of 15 percent.

Welcome aboard! Our public REST API (Mapletrail) paginates everything with cursor tokens — no page numbers, so don't try offset math. Grab the `next_cursor` from each response and pass it back until it's null. To test against the internal sandbox gateway, you'll need to authenticate your requests, and the key for that is right below.

app token of yajeg-kawef = kto11_7En3XSX8xQw